Restitution and Stability of Human Ventricular Action Potential at High And Variable Pacing Rate (Biophysical Journal)
 


Despite the key role of beat-to-beat action potential (AP) variability in the onset of ventricular arrhythmias at high pacing rate, the knowledge of the involved dynamics and of effective prognostic parameters is largely incomplete. Electrical restitution (ER), the way AP duration (APD) senses changes in preceding cycle length (CL), has been used to monitor transition to arrhythmias. The use of standard ER (sER) though, is controversial, not always suitable for in-vivo, and only rarely for clinical applications.
